For those in the know,

Is it possible to have documents apostilled in Korea?

Will they be accepted by the Ministry of Education or do you have to have it done in your home country?

An apostille is done by your country to legalize a document for international use.

So, the short answer would be no, you cannot have it done "in Korea" but if you are in Korea you can have it sent home to have an apostille affixed to it.

Depending on where you are from, an embassy authentication is also accepted (not an option for Americans since YOUR embassy won't authenticate anything).
